Did some crappy notes, if anyone has better ones please replace mine

:arrow: No moderation of custom content, occasional community highlights of age-appropriate (teen) content. Beamdog not promoting Sinfar but also not trying to censor them was mentioned directly. (seeing actual people say 'Sinfar' in front of an audience was a strange moment)

:arrow: Patches or some sort of progress notes every week or so possibly

:arrow: Desire to make a persistant world starter kit with the community

:arrow: Far future UI changes

:arrow: "Short answer yes" on NWN supporting normal maps

:arrow: Plans to make server hosting more stable for higher player numbers
Liareth wrote:One of the great things about this release, is that we've implemented all of the performance enhancements that we used on Arelith, into the base game.
:arrow: Module Resource limit being looked at, probably can be increased

:arrow: Hakpack auto-downloader being looked at?

:arrow: More shaders, better shader support

:arrow: Looking at making druids/shifters not polymorphs for things like a Natural Spell feat, apparently

seriously I might've missed something or misinterpreted, feel free to correct me
